The predetermined overhead rate is multiplied by the actual allocation base incurred by a job to find the applied overhead.

<h3>How to calculate the overhead applied in a job</h3>

Applied overhead is a fixed rate charged to a specific production job, good produced, or department within an organization.

This overhead applied are calculated by finding the product of the predetermined overhead rate and the actual allocation base incured by a job

Hence we can conclude that the predetermined overhead rate is multiplied by the actual allocation base incurred by a job to find the applied overhead.
